The highlight of the Tech In Asia is the Arena Startup Pitch Battle where 6 startups pitch their products and services live on stage. Japan’s Empath came out on top today after beating five other candidates to bag the prize. Empath uses AI to identify emotions in the human voice in real time, regardless of language. By analyzing factors such as pitch, tone, and speed, Empath is able to detect four emotions – joy, calm, anger, and sorrow. The startup caters mainly to call centers in Japan, helping them increase their sales rate by an average of 20 percent. Empath is already profitable and has managed to achieve a US$1 million per year run rate. It services 700 clients in 47 countries worldwide.
